Course Information

Windyhill Golf Club, Strathclyde is an 18 hole, par 71 (6154 yard), private, parkland golf course designed by James Braid in 1908.

18 holes | Par 71 | 6154 yards | Private | Parkland

Jean L rated 5 out of 5

Reviewed Mar 21 2015

Lovely course design and picturesque scenery. Uphill, downhill, sidehill, lots of variety of shots to play. Many of the par 4s require carries of 250+ yds to hope reaching in two. Greens just sanded and still recovering from winter - members say they get fast in summer making slopes in greens a much more serious challenge.

Fraser W rated 4 out of 5

Reviewed Aug 1 2015



(Round played: Aug 2015 - Score: 106 Handicap: 24.5)

Undulating course with several blind summits, full of features blending parkland seamlessly with rugged moorland. Promotes stunning views across the City of Glasgow to the South and the Campsie Fells to the North making the round a pleasure, no matter the score.
